The DVLA Implements Strengthened Safety Features for New Driving Permits

The UK's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) has rolled out enhanced security features on newly issued driving licences. These upgrades are designed to mitigate fraud and guarantee the authenticity of driving permits. The updated licences will feature a range of sophisticated security measures, including holograms.

The DVLA states that these improvements will substantially lower the risk of licence forgery and provide increased protection for drivers. Additionally, the new licences are expected to improve the authentication process for law enforcement agencies.

Owners of current driving licences will not be instantly affected by these changes. The revised security features will only affect licences granted on or after a specific date.
